Plutarch (Plutarchus), Ca. Ad 45120, Was Born At Chaeronea In Boeotia In Central Greece, Studied Philosophy At Athens, And, After Coming To Rome As A Teacher In Philosophy, Was Given Consular Rank By The Emperor Trajan And A Procuratorship In Greece By Hadrian. He Was Married And The Father Of One Daughter And Four Sons. He Appears As A Man Of Kindly Character And Independent Thought,
